Войти

Показать полную графическую версию : Разделы на Raid 10


pva
22-02-2008, 13:00
Допустим есть чередующийся массив из 3-х зеркал, итого 6 дисков. Как организуется хранение партишенов на такой штуковине? имеет ли смысл их разбивать? В том смысле, что если, например, первый партишн уложится только на первом зеркале, то смысла от чередования нету :(... или там всё по-умному делается?

Antech
22-02-2008, 13:32
pva
Нет смысла в каком-то особом разделении. Вы можете создать разделы по вкусу.

Инфа на оба диска одного зеркала пишется одинаково (параллельно), сектор в сектор.
Что касается нескольких зеркал, включенных в страйп, то здесь алгоритм аналогичен обычному страйпу (RAID0). На iXBT кто-то приводил очень наглядный пример. Представьте себе две расчески, вставленные зубьями друг в друга. Теперь напишем краской какое-нибудь слово на этих расческах. Слово - это Ваша инфа. Т. е. каждый более/менее крупный файл (не говоря уже о разделах) распределяется по трем (в данном случае) зеркалам. Ширина зуба расчески (размер страйпа) AFAIK обычно 64 КБ. Так что "первый партишн" будет расположен на всех трех Ваших зеркалах.

Если интересно, рекомендую почитать какой-нибудь FAQ (http://www.nklondike.ru/raidnew/raid4.htm) по уровням RAID.




© OSzone.net 2001-2012